Update for simpler lesson
This commit is contained in:
parent
a39f7bfc1f
commit
3bd4c21cca
Binary file not shown.
@ -8,51 +8,31 @@
|
|||||||
\begin{document}
|
\begin{document}
|
||||||
\maketitle
|
\maketitle
|
||||||
|
|
||||||
\section{Historique}
|
|
||||||
\begin{description}
|
|
||||||
\item [1965] Invention et programmation du concept d’hypertexte par Ted Nelson
|
|
||||||
\item [1989] Première page web au CERN par Tim Berners Lee
|
|
||||||
\item [1993] Mise dans le domaine public, disponibilité du premier navigateur Mosaic
|
|
||||||
\item [2001] Standardisation des pages grâce au DOM (Document Object Model)
|
|
||||||
\end{description}
|
|
||||||
|
|
||||||
\section{Qu’est-ce que le web ?}
|
\section{Qu’est-ce que le web ?}
|
||||||
\begin{definition}
|
\begin{definition}
|
||||||
Le web est un système utilisant internet et servant à publier des \textbf{ressources} (par exemple des documents textes et multimédia).
|
Le web est un réseau d’échange de documents (pages web, multimédia, etc) utilisant internet.
|
||||||
\end{definition}
|
|
||||||
|
|
||||||
\section{Fonctionnement}
|
|
||||||
Comment peut-on récupérer des documents sur internet depuis notre ordinateur ou téléphone ?
|
|
||||||
|
|
||||||
\subsection{Client et serveur}
|
|
||||||
\begin{definition}
|
|
||||||
Les ressources sont stockées sur un serveur web connecté à internet.\\
|
|
||||||
Un navigateur (ou client) également connecté à internet peut donc lui envoyer une \textbf{requête web}, demandant une ressource précise.\\
|
|
||||||
La \textbf{réponse} contiendra cette ressource si elle existe.
|
|
||||||
\end{definition}
|
\end{definition}
|
||||||
|
|
||||||
\begin{definition}
|
\begin{definition}
|
||||||
Un navigateur web est un logiciel capable de récupérer des documents sur le web et d’afficher des pages web.
|
Un navigateur web est un logiciel capable de récupérer des documents sur le web et d’afficher des pages web.
|
||||||
\end{definition}
|
\end{definition}
|
||||||
|
|
||||||
\subsection{URLs}
|
\section{URLs}
|
||||||
On identifie les fichiers grâce à une URL pour « Uniform Ressource Locator » ou en français : « localisateur uniforme de ressource ».
|
On identifie les fichiers grâce à une URL pour « Uniform Ressource Locator » ou en français : « localisateur uniforme de ressource ».
|
||||||
\begin{definition}
|
\begin{definition}
|
||||||
Une URL est de la forme suivante :\\
|
Une URL est de la forme suivante :\\
|
||||||
\textcolor{red}{https://}\textcolor{blue}{www.julesguesde.fr}\textcolor{green}{/LIENS}
|
\textcolor{red}{https://}\textcolor{blue}{www.julesguesde.fr}\textcolor{green}{/LIENS}\textcolor{black}{?lang=fr}
|
||||||
\begin{description}
|
\begin{description}
|
||||||
\item[\textcolor{red}{https://}] Le protocole utilisé pour récupérer la ressource. HTTP pour le web, HTTPS avec un chiffrement.
|
\item[\textcolor{red}{https://}] Le protocole utilisé pour récupérer la ressource. HTTP pour le web, HTTPS avec un chiffrement.
|
||||||
\item[\textcolor{blue}{www.julesguesde.fr}] Est l’adresse IP du serveur (ou un nom symbolique qui sera traduit par l’adresse).
|
\item[\textcolor{blue}{www.julesguesde.fr}] Est le nom du serveur qui stock la ressource.
|
||||||
\item[\textcolor{green}{/LIENS}] Est le chemin du document que l’on souhaite récupérer sur le serveur.
|
\item[\textcolor{green}{/LIENS}] Est le chemin du document que l’on souhaite récupérer sur le serveur.
|
||||||
|
\item[\textcolor{black}{?lang=fr}] Sont des paramètres permettant de personnaliser la page.
|
||||||
\end{description}
|
\end{description}
|
||||||
\end{definition}
|
\end{definition}
|
||||||
|
|
||||||
\section{Types de ressources}
|
|
||||||
Tous les fichiers peuvent être servis par un serveur web que ce soit du texte, une vidéo, un programme…\\
|
|
||||||
Ces fichiers sont téléchargés par le navigateur sur notre ordinateur.\\
|
|
||||||
|
|
||||||
\subsection{Les documents HTML}
|
\section{Documents et pages web}
|
||||||
Un type de fichier est cependant traité différement : les pages web.
|
Tous les fichiers peuvent être mis sur le web. Un type de fichier est cependant traité différement : les pages web.
|
||||||
Une page web est un fichier texte dont le contenu est structuré par le format HTML pour « HyperText Markup Language » ou « langage de balisage hypertexte ».
|
Une page web est un fichier texte dont le contenu est structuré par le format HTML pour « HyperText Markup Language » ou « langage de balisage hypertexte ».
|
||||||
\begin{definition}
|
\begin{definition}
|
||||||
Le HTML permet de structurer un document et de donner un sens sémantique au texte.
|
Le HTML permet de structurer un document et de donner un sens sémantique au texte.
|
||||||
@ -66,7 +46,6 @@ On peut donc mettre des titres, des paragraphes et d’autres éléments de stru
|
|||||||
\lstinputlisting[language=HTML,linerange={1-4,6-12}]{example.html}
|
\lstinputlisting[language=HTML,linerange={1-4,6-12}]{example.html}
|
||||||
\includegraphics[width=\textwidth]{example.png}
|
\includegraphics[width=\textwidth]{example.png}
|
||||||
\end{centering}
|
\end{centering}
|
||||||
|
|
||||||
\end{example}
|
\end{example}
|
||||||
|
|
||||||
\subsection{Les feuilles de style}
|
\subsection{Les feuilles de style}
|
||||||
|
@ -1,12 +1,3 @@
|
|||||||
<!DOCTYPE html>
|
<h1>Titre !</h1>
|
||||||
<html>
|
<p>Un paragraphe de texte</p>
|
||||||
<head>
|
|
||||||
<title>Un exemple de site</title>
|
|
||||||
<link rel="stylesheet" href="example.css" />
|
|
||||||
</head>
|
|
||||||
<body>
|
|
||||||
<h1>Titre !</h1>
|
|
||||||
<p>Un paragraphe de texte</p>
|
|
||||||
</body>
|
|
||||||
</html>
|
|
||||||
|
|
||||||
|
Binary file not shown.
Before Width: | Height: | Size: 12 KiB After Width: | Height: | Size: 12 KiB |
Binary file not shown.
Before Width: | Height: | Size: 12 KiB After Width: | Height: | Size: 9.2 KiB |
Loading…
Reference in New Issue
Block a user